Letter[edit]

  1. A vowel of the Bengali script.

Usage notes[edit]

Its matra, used to modify the inherent vowel in a consonant, is written . For example, the first consonant ক with the matra looks like: কে.

Etymology 2[edit]

Inherited from Sanskrit एष (eṣa), from a compound of Proto-Indo-European *éy + .

Pronoun[edit]

(e) (objective একে (eke), possessive এর (er))

  1. (informally) he, she, it
  2. this
